Hi All,

 

The dashboard is showing 33% Expense on the dashboard, while no data is entered in the newly subscribed/fresh instance. Please guide if its bug or any other issue? Ref snap shot is  also attached.

To start with, let's begin by accessing your account in a new incognito or private window of your browser. This way, we can check if this unexpected behavior is related to your current browser or not. To do so:

  • Google Chrome: Ctrl + Shift + N
  • Internet Explorer: Ctrl + Shift + P
  • Mozilla Firefox: Ctrl + Shift + P
  • Safari: Command + Option + P

Once completed, you can log back in to your account and check if you still see the expenses on your dashboard. If you're not seeing those digits, you can clear your browser's cache to optimize it. Also, your browser can start from scratch and improve your QuickBooks Online browsing experience.
 
However, if you can still see the expenses on your dashboard, let's switch and use a new browser application. Then, log back into your account and check your dashboard from there.

I have more steps we can try. Let's click on the graph to see if there are transactions recorded previously. Let me guide you how.

  1. On your Expenses graph, click on one section of the graph to open a report.
  2. A transaction report will open. From there, you can verify if these are valid transactions.
